| 附加信息 |
This sestertius falls within Domitian's tenure as Caesar under his father Vespasian, struck before his accession in 81 AD. Spes — Hope — as a reverse type carried specific political weight during the Flavian dynasty's early years: Vespasian had emerged from the chaos of 69 AD, the Year of the Four Emperors, and the repeated use of optimistic personifications on Flavian coinage was a deliberate program of dynastic reassurance rather than incidental iconography.
RIC II.1 #656 places this among the reorganized Flavian attributions from the revised second edition, which substantially renumbered earlier RIC II assignments for this period.
